Time: Every year on the fifth day of the ninth lunar month Location: Shibi Village Activity history: 9 Activity impact: 8 Participation index: 8.5 Introduction: Shibi, Ninghua, is a sacred place for Hakka people to trace their roots and pay homage to their ancestors; and the Hakka Temple is the ancestral temple of Hakka people around the world. Since the completion of the Hakka Temple in 1995, more than 500,000 Hakka people from more than 30 countries on five continents, thousands of ancestral worship associations have come to participate in the pious worship, and return to their hometown in body and mind. Through worship, the past and present of the Hakka people are connected, and the spiritual corridor of the Hakka people is also constructed.
